0
0

Delete article

Deleted articles cannot be recovered.

Draft of this article would be also deleted.

Are you sure you want to delete this article?

More than 1 year has passed since last update.

Firebase Crashlytics

Last updated at Posted at 2023-03-25

以下は、FlutterでFirebase Crashlyticsを使用するための基本的なコースです。

1.Firebaseプロジェクトの作成:Firebase Crashlyticsを使用するには、Firebaseプロジェクトを作成する必要があります。Firebaseコンソールにログインして、新しいプロジェクトを作成してください。

2.Flutterアプリの設定:FlutterアプリでFirebase Crashlyticsを使用するには、firebase_coreとfirebase_crashlyticsパッケージをプロジェクトに追加する必要があります。pubspec.yamlファイルを開き、以下の依存関係を追加してください。

dependencies:
  firebase_core: ^1.4.0
  firebase_crashlytics: ^2.5.2

3.Firebaseプロジェクトの設定:FirebaseプロジェクトにFlutterアプリを追加するには、Firebaseコンソールからアプリを追加する必要があります。Flutterアプリのパッケージ名を入力し、Googleサービスの構成ファイル(google-services.json)をダウンロードして、アプリのルートディレクトリに保存してください。

4.Firebase Crashlyticsの設定:Firebase Crashlyticsを使用するには、FirebaseCrashlyticsインスタンスを初期化する必要があります。main.dartファイルを開き、以下のコードを追加してください。

import 'package:firebase_core/firebase_core.dart';
import 'package:firebase_crashlytics/firebase_crashlytics.dart';

void main() async {
  WidgetsFlutterBinding.ensureInitialized();
  await Firebase.initializeApp();
  FirebaseCrashlytics.instance.setCrashlyticsCollectionEnabled(true);
  FlutterError.onError = FirebaseCrashlytics.instance.recordFlutterError;
  runApp(MyApp());
}

5.アプリのクラッシュをトリガー:Firebase Crashlyticsをテストするには、アプリでクラッシュをトリガーする必要があります。例えば、以下のようなコードを使用して、意図的なクラッシュを発生させることができます。

FirebaseCrashlytics.instance.crash();

これで、FlutterアプリでFirebase Crashlyticsを使用するための基本的な手順が完了しました。Firebaseコンソールからアプリのクラッシュレポートを確認することができます。

0
0
0

Register as a new user and use Qiita more conveniently

  1. You get articles that match your needs
  2. You can efficiently read back useful information
  3. You can use dark theme
What you can do with signing up
0
0

Delete article

Deleted articles cannot be recovered.

Draft of this article would be also deleted.

Are you sure you want to delete this article?